Output 691670800e32ed13b3157df35883b85dc017612ab83a65242ec781e3e5a22cdd:0

value
494567560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9880b23faeb6ed49f72cedc50957a2ea74af1e91 OP_EQUAL
address
3FbNogCEGN7MN6HvfJuhCiCJN5h6aTxhmd
transaction
691670800e32ed13b3157df35883b85dc017612ab83a65242ec781e3e5a22cdd
spent
true